2002 frame question

My 02 2500 HD 4x4 crew swb Duramax was hit in the left front a couple weeks ago and left me with a bent frame and cracked front diff. I’ve located a frame for a 05 ext cab 4x4 lwb that has the front diff in it for cheap. My question is concerning the way GM built the frames. I know there is a junction where a front and rear section are welded together. Can I use the front section of the ext cab lwb to replace the front section of the crew cab swb? Thanks for your help!
